Guys, just fitted a new fuel pump to my 1983 rangie 3.5v8 on carbs. Its the facet type bolted to the rear outrigger on the passenger side. Trouble is its ticking away but not pumping fuel to the carbs. I assume I need to prime it but cant work out how. Can some one give me some tips please. tried a search but no good.
 
should not need priming..but if it does pour some fuel into inlet..?

you fitted correctly??and checked fuel filter is clean etc..

no one answered cos nothing to get wrong really..
 
Sometimes happens if your low on fuel. Stick a rag in the filler with a tube through it and blow to shove some fuel up the pipe. If you have big lungs it may work. I usually used a gentle puff with an air line. You may have a split in the pickup pipe?
 
It might sound stupid but check the wires are the right way around. I saw something similar a while back on an efi Rangie, pump would run but no fuel; turned out replacement fuel pump was wired the wrong way around so it was trying to suck the fuel back in to the tank! Swapped feed and ground over and all was good.
 
On a rotary pump maybe, but not on the reciprocating diaphragm pump. Pipes could be on wrong way round though.
 
yes pipe on wrong or blockage.

you didnt re locate it to higher up did you as they can only lift to a certain height
